Riehen is a municipality in the canton of Basel-Stadt in Switzerland. Together with the city of Basel and Bettingen, Riehen is one of three municipalities in the canton.

Riehen hosts the Fondation Beyeler as well as a toy museum. It also features numerous heritage sites of national significance: the church of St. Martin, several residential houses as well as the Wenkenhof estate.
Riehen was the first municipality in Switzerland to elect a woman, Trudy Späth-Schweizer to political office in 1958.
